liking him so let’s go ahead let’s build this thing right now block four block let’s go all right and here we go with the block palette so we’re gonna be bringing in some mushroom Stem blocks some dark oak planks the stairs the fences some spruce trap doors some nether wart block crimson nalium any glass of your choice and then also some bricks some brick stairs and some campfire blocks and here we go with the dimensions it is super Easy all you’re going to be needing is a 5×5 box frame to get this foundation started also we’re going to be using the mushroom stem block for this block you’re going to need some silk touch so if you don’t have that available i’m going to give you later on a couple Options that you can use instead also if you didn’t head off to the nether and you couldn’t get any nether wart block or any of this crimson nylon yet i’m going to also give you other options that you can use this style this build specifically can be used with so Many different block combinations but i’ll show you that after but for right now let’s get it started so let’s start right here on this corner of this 5×5 with a dark oak plank we’re going to be using our mushroom
